Illustrated with two sections of both black-and-white and color photographic plates and black-and-white frontispiece drawing. "In this compelling and original history Lt. Colonel Mike Snook sheds intriguing new light on military disaster during the high Victorian period. With the empire at its zenith this was an era that witnessed some of the British Army's greatest colonial successes. It was also a period of troubled transition as the army struggled to adapt to the changing nature and needs of modern warfare. Focusing on some of the most dramatic and celebrated campaigns of the age - from Isandlwana, Maiwand and Majuba Hill to Khartoum, Colenso, Spion Kop and Magersfontein - the author combines engaging battle narratives with a scrupulous examination of primary source material to bring these encounters to life and expose the true and sometimes embarrassing causes of defeat." - from the rear outer jacket. "The experience of colonial warfare brought vividly to life. New insights into the characters of some of Victoria's most notable military commanders. Tabulated orders of battle for all combatants. Between the Crimean War and the dawn of the 20th century, the British Army was alsmost continuously engaged, in one corner of the globe or another, in military operations famously characterized by Kipling as the 'savage wars of peace.' From Cairo to Cape Town, hard-pressed handfuls of British soldiers flogged across often impossible terrain, and overcame a raft of logistic difficulties, to bring a succession of resourceful enemies to battle. When at length the protagonists met at close quarters, there were often startling, unexpected and violent outcomes. In his new worl Lieutenant Colonel Mike Snook deploys his professional expertise as a soldier, in concert with his life-long study of British military history, to bring the most dramatic clashes of the age of empire back to life. The names of these great battles - Isandlwana, Maiwand, Majuba Hill, Khartoum, Colenso, Spion Kop and Magersfontein still resonate down through the ages. In a wide-ranging and meticulously researched military history, the author focuses closely on defeat and disaster - the occasions when things went badly awry for the British. Overstretch, political meddling, military incompetence and petty jealousy all played their part. Above all else, however, these are dramatic and perceptive accounts of mere mortal men struggling to deal with the often overpowering dynamics and horrors of 19th -century warfare on the fringes of Empire." - from the inner front jacket flap.
